    <title>Squidoo: Eggplant, Aubergine, Brinjal</title>
    <link>http://www.feedest.com/feedShow.cfm/feed/55564C7A5C46</link>
    <description>
    <![CDATA[
      The eggplant, also know as aubergine or brinjal is a plant from the family of the nightshades and thus closely related to tomatoes, potatoes and peppers. The fruit, which is used as a vegetable in cooking is known with the same name. The plant comes originally from India and Sri Lanka, but is meanwhile cultivated in almost the whole world.

The produced fruit of the domesticated plants is much bigger than the maximum 3 cm small fruit growing at wild plants. ...
